How to Generate More Leads with Google Business Profile

Enhanced Keyword Research and Placement

Google Business Profile is a powerful tool that can help businesses improve their visibility and reach potential customers. One way to leverage Google Business Profile is through enhanced keyword research and placement. By conducting keyword research, you can identify the keywords that potential customers are using to search for businesses like yours. You can then strategically include these keywords in your content to optimize your Google Business Profile listing, which will help improve your ranking in search results and make it easy for potential customers to find you.

Better Competitor Analysis

Competitor analysis is a process of identifying your competitors and evaluating their strategies to determine their strengths and weaknesses in relation to your own business. This information can then be used to help you develop and improve your own digital marketing strategies.

There are several benefits to conducting competitor analysis, including gaining insights into your competition’s marketing and advertising strategies, product offerings, and pricing. This information can help you develop strategies to improve your own visibility and attract more customers.

In addition, understanding your competitors can help you identify areas where you may be able to gain a competitive advantage. For example, suppose your competitors are not making full use of Google Business Profile features. In that case, you can use this to your advantage by ensuring that your profile is complete and optimized. Overall, doing competitor analysis is a valuable exercise that can help you enhance your Google Business Profile and attract more customers.

Choose the Right Business Category

Your Google Business Profile is critical to your success as a business owner. It is the first thing potential customers will see when they search for your business online, and it can help you stand out from the competition.

Choosing the right business category can help you build a strong Google Business Profile. The right category can also help you get found on Google Maps and Google search results more easily. When you choose a business category, be sure to select one that accurately reflects what your business does. You can also use keyword research to help you choose a category that will make it easier for your target customers to find you online.

Update Local Directories

Updating your local directories helps build your Google Business Profile in several ways, as it helps ensure that your business information is accurate, consistent, and up-to-date. This is important because potential customers need to be able to find the correct business information to do business with you. In fact, your clients might lose trust in you and choose your competition if they find that your information is inconsistent or inaccurate.

Updating your local directories can also help improve your business’s ranking in search results. This is because Google takes into account the accuracy and completeness of your business information when determining where to rank your business in search results. Finally, updating your local directories can also help you reach more potential customers. This is because when potential customers search for products and services you offer, your business will be more likely to appear in the search results, allowing you to reach more customers and grow your brand.

Focus on Getting More Customer Reviews

The more reviews you have, the more likely customers are to trust your business. Good reviews can help improve your business’s ranking in search results. Additionally, customers who leave positive reviews are more likely to come back and use your business again in the future.

So how can you get more customer reviews? One way is to simply ask customers after they’ve made a purchase or used your service. You can also include a link to your Google Business Profile in your email signature, on your website, or on social media. If you have a brick-and-mortar location, you can also include a sign asking customers to leave a review.

Enable Messaging on Your Google Business Profile

When you turn on messaging on your Google My Business profile, you’re giving potential customers a way to get in touch with you directly. This can help build your Google Business Profile by giving you an opportunity to respond to customer inquiries and show off your customer service skills. In addition, customers who message you may be more likely to leave a review or rating on your profile, which can also help build your profile and improve your visibility in search results.
